    DESCRIPTION
 | 
			
		||||
        "This MIB module is for the management of N_Port Virtualization
 | 
			
		||||
         or NPV within the framework of N_Port virtualization(NPV)
 | 
			
		||||
         architecture.
 | 
			
		||||
 | 
			
		||||
         N_Port virtualization reduces the number of Fibre Channel
 | 
			
		||||
         domain IDs in SANs(Storage Area Network).  Switches operating
 | 
			
		||||
         in the NPV mode do not join a fabric; rather, they pass traffic
 | 
			
		||||
         between NPV core switch links and end-devices, which eliminates
 | 
			
		||||
         the domain IDs for these edge switches.  NPV core switch is a
 | 
			
		||||
         fibre channel edge switch connected to one or more NPV devices."

hh3cNpvTrafficMapConfigEntry OBJECT-TYPE
 | 
			
		||||
    SYNTAX          Hh3cNpvTrafficMapConfigEntry
 | 
			
		||||
    MAX-ACCESS      not-accessible
 | 
			
		||||
    STATUS          current
 | 
			
		||||
    DESCRIPTION
 | 
			
		||||
        "An entry in the hh3cNpvTrafficMapConfigTable.
 | 
			
		||||
 | 
			
		||||
        This table contains entries for each of the interfaces
 | 
			
		||||
        which has been assigned a set of interfaces for traffic
 | 
			
		||||
        mapping in the VSAN.
 | 
			
		||||
 | 
			
		||||
        Traffic mapping is a technique used in NPV device to
 | 
			
		||||
        restrict the usage of external interface(s) for forwarding
 | 
			
		||||
        the traffic from server interface to the fibre channel fabric.
 | 
			
		||||
 | 
			
		||||
        If an interface comes up as a server interface and finds
 | 
			
		||||
        a corresponding entry in this table, then the switch
 | 
			
		||||
        software will assign a valid external interface from
 | 
			
		||||
        this list, if any.  Once assigned, that assigned external
 | 
			
		||||
        interface will be used for forwarding the traffic from
 | 
			
		||||
        the server interface to the fibre channel fabric.
 | 
			
		||||
 | 
			
		||||
        If an interface comes up as a server interface and
 | 
			
		||||
        finds an entry in this table, but with no valid list of
 | 
			
		||||
        external interfaces, then the switch software keeps the
 | 
			
		||||
        server interface in operationally down state until
 | 
			
		||||
        at least one of the interface in the list becomes a
 | 
			
		||||
        valid external interface.
 | 
			
		||||
 | 
			
		||||
        If an interface comes up as a server interface and it
 | 
			
		||||
        cannot find an entry in this table, then any of the
 | 
			
		||||
        available external interfaces can be assigned to that
 | 
			
		||||
        server interface.
 | 
			
		||||
 | 
			
		||||
        Entries in this table can be created or destroyed via
 | 
			
		||||
        hh3cNpvTrafficMapRowStatus object.  Columnar objects can be
 | 
			
		||||
        modified when the corresponding hh3cNpvTrafficMapRowStatus
 | 
			
		||||
        is 'active'."
